We teach Hatha yoga in the traditional methods of Iyengar and Ashtanga.  Hatha uses postures, in combination with the breath to develop flexibility and calmness.   Our primary focus is on safety, and we teach careful alignment combined with conscious breath and quiet mind.   We do not heat our rooms, as we believe the body fares best when allowed its own natural course of warming up and cooling down Yoga is for everyone. If you show up, breath, and try your best, you'll notice immediate benefits. All classes are encouraging and supportive. 


 There are many styles of yoga practiced today, yet all styles have derived from classical hatha yoga, and the Iyengar and Ashtanga Lineage brought to the West.

    YIN Yoga Designed to release tension deep in our muscles, connective tissue & fascia. All poses are floor poses, concentrated Ion pelvis, hips & low back.. We let go of all alignment as we sink into our bolsters/blankets  Give yourself permission to slow down!

    Work out clothes, sweatpants, etc. Avoid jeans, street clothes that are to tight as well as any shirt that might be to baggy, or get in the way of movement. Don't worry about shoes, and we are barefoot in yoga practice. Shoes are to be removed in the hallway (you an keep socks on, until on your mat).  Please avoid heavy perfumes.


    Please bring yoga mat if you have one. If not, we have a few extra. If you borrow, please wipe it down with supplied spray in the studio. Please replace all props in their location.


    Try to arrive 10 minutes early, especially if you are new.  Space is limited, so keep your footprint small.  Relish the quiet.  We are all here to find peace & equanimity. As we enter the studio space with just your mat, find your "space"  to quietly sit or start stretching. Yoga is an Internal Practice, not an external exercise.
